> Hi there. You basically have the right idea. In addition to saying the actual 
> word for the comma, and the period, you speak the names of the other 
> punctuations. Question mark for ? And exclamation mark for !
> 
> When you do this, you will find that the correct punctuation is used. I will 
> give you an example of one sentence that comes out and then how I actually 
> dictated it.
> 
> I really love my iPhone! It is the best thing that happened to me, I am 
> kidding of course. Right?
> 
> I really love my iPhone exclamation mark it is the best thing that happened 
> to me comma I am kidding of course period Right question mark
